ASI Merge: Uniting Fetch.ai, Ocean Protocol, and SingularityNET

The much-anticipated ASI merge of Fetch.ai, Ocean Protocol, and SingularityNET into the Artificial Superintelligence Alliance (ASI) is set to revolutionize the decentralized AI ecosystem. This integration will streamline operations, enhance interoperability, and position ASI as a leading force in decentralized AI. Here’s an in-depth look at this significant transition.

Phase I: Initial Integration and Rebranding

Key Actions and Timeline

July 1, 2024:

  • Token Merge: AGIX and OCEAN will temporarily merge into FET under the ASI banner.
  • Rebranding: The project will be rebranded across major platforms as the Artificial Superintelligence Alliance.
  • Market Continuity: FET trading will continue uninterrupted, ensuring market stability.

Migration Process:

  • Deposits and Withdrawals: AGIX and OCEAN deposits and withdrawals will halt in preparation for migration.
  • Conversion: Migration contracts for converting AGIX and OCEAN to FET will be available on the SingularityDAO dApp.
  • Automatic Conversion: Exchange-held tokens on platforms like Binance will be automatically converted to FET and subsequently to ASI.

Phase II: Community Onboarding and Network Upgrade

Focus Areas

Community Engagement:

  • Self-Custody Holders: Priority access for those who self-custody their funds, ensuring a smooth onboarding process.
  • Scam Awareness: Vigilance against scams, emphasizing that no private information will be required.

Network Enhancements:

  • ASI Token Deployment: Introduction of ASI tokens across various blockchains.
  • Network Upgrade: Fetch.ai network will upgrade to the ASI network, incorporating advanced performance, security, and scalability features.

Conversion Contracts:

  • Supported Wallets: Compatibility with major software and hardware wallets, with easy-to-follow conversion processes.
  • Extended Conversion Window: No immediate pressure to convert, with a long-term window for transitioning.

Conversion Rates:

  • AGIX to ASI: 1 AGIX = 0.433350 ASI
  • OCEAN to ASI: 1 OCEAN = 0.433226 ASI
  • FET to ASI: 1 FET = 1 ASI

Coinbase Issue

Coinbase has decided not to support the upcoming migration of the Artificial Superintelligence Alliance (ASI) for its users, which involves a $7.5 billion token merger between AI protocols SingularityNet, Fetch.ai, and Ocean Protocol.

Crypto service providers supporting this process will automatically convert users’ token holdings on the specified day. However, Coinbase has opted out, stating, “Coinbase will not execute the migration of these assets on behalf of users.”

As an alternative, Coinbase will continue to allow FET and OCEAN trades until further notice and has provided a workaround for users:

“Once the migration has launched, users will be able to migrate their OCEAN and FET to ASI using a self-custodial wallet, such as Coinbase Wallet. The ASI token merger will be compatible with all major software wallets.”
